Transaction 31e66b697fe4693595ba24cf21f9a9986ff4ca61476f9c74171269ba61c85eaa
1 Input
1 Output
-
31e66b697fe4693595ba24cf21f9a9986ff4ca61476f9c74171269ba61c85eaa:0
- value
- 12858556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24dd6a15bb81b1690baf5010bc7c579c8ba45fb3 OP_EQUAL
- address
- 353wVbFuQLJ8zUyRvWE3WsJCrTDokZ1zyy